My client are a national civil engineering contractor who are currently seeking a Site Engineer to cover multiple water schemes across the Midlands, with an immediate start available. This role will suit someone who is comfortable taking on some supervisory responsibilities alongside engineering duties.
Site Engineer Responsibilities:
- Toolbox talks
- Client liaison
- Health and safety compliance
- Setting out works across multiple water treatment and infrastructure sites
- Supervising subcontractors and site activities
- Ensuring works are delivered on programme and to specification
- Managing QA documentation and as-built records
- Assisting with surveys and resolving technical issues
- Supporting site management with day-to-day supervision
Site Engineer Requirements:
- Black or Gold CSCS
- Previous experience working as a Site Engineer on water treatment or water infrastructure schemes
- Strong setting out and surveying experience
- Willingness to take on supervisory duties
- IT literate
- Full UK driving licence
